Output 33352e39cbdf438c53ffce9dab4fe60fde15e0beec8d9e850ee1372e770c41fa:1

value
670825568
script pubkey
OP_0 OP_PUSHBYTES_20 d3cc1e2cd7719233299078443eb119134dfaa66c
address
bc1q60xputxhwxfrx2vs0pzravgezdxl4fnv2zmj5e
transaction
33352e39cbdf438c53ffce9dab4fe60fde15e0beec8d9e850ee1372e770c41fa